Thanks for the prompt reply... Here it is
Application status We are processing your application. We will send you a message when there is an update or if we need more information from you. Help
Review of eligibility We are reviewing whether you meet the eligibility requirements.
Review of medical results You passed the medical exam.
Review of additional documents We do not need additional documents.
Background check Not applicable.

Thanks again
 
Thanks for the prompt reply... Here it is
Application status We are processing your application. We will send you a message when there is an update or if we need more information from you. Help
Review of eligibility We are reviewing whether you meet the eligibility requirements.
Review of medical results You passed the medical exam.
Review of additional documents We do not need additional documents.
Background check Not applicable.

Thanks again
That's is IP1. Your next step will be NA2 >>> IP2 >>> PPR Email

For your input, IP2 will look like this:

Background check We are processing your background check. We will send you a message if we need more information.
